预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

面向能耗均衡的无线传感器网络路由协议研究 随着无线传感器网络技术的快速发展,越来越多的应用场景需要使用传感器网络来进行数据采集和监控。在这些应用中,无线传感器节点通常被部署在不易到达和设备维护较困难的环境中。因此,设计高效且能耗均衡的路由协议对于无线传感器网络的可持续运行至关重要。 本论文旨在研究面向能耗均衡的无线传感器网络路由协议,首先介绍无线传感器网络和传感器网络中节点的能源限制问题;然后,分析已有的传感器网络路由协议的优缺点,同时介绍现有的能量均衡路由协议及其实现原理;最后,提出一种新的基于能量均衡的路由协议。 一、无线传感器网络和能量限制问题 无线传感器网络是由大量的小型无线传感器节点组成的具有自组织和自适应能力的分布式系统。传感器节点通常由处理器、传感器和通信模块等硬件组成。这些节点在各个位置监测和采集环境信息,然后把这些信息汇总起来传输到控制中心。 但是,无线传感器节点的能源有限,如果节点的能量消耗过快,那么节点很快就会失去运行能力,这会影响整个传感器网络的运行。因此,设计高效的能耗均衡路由协议非常重要。 二、现有的无线传感器网络路由协议 传统的路由协议包括Flooding、最短路径优先和链路状态路由。在这些协议中,传统的最短路径优先和链路状态路由协议的优点是在短时间内可以快速找到最短路径,但由于传感器节点之间的距离远近不同且节点的能源有限,传统路由协议无法保证网络中所有节点的能耗均衡。此外,Flooding协议虽然具有最好的网络可达性和容错性,但消息泛洪消耗大量的能量,从而缩短网络的寿命。 为了更好地处理能源限制问题,许多新的路由协议被提出,例如能量感知路由协议、链路预测路由协议、粒子群算法等。这些协议采取不同的路由策略,但它们的原则是为了实现传感器节点之间的能耗均衡。 三、能耗均衡路由协议及其实现原理 在现有的能量均衡路由协议中,许多协议都是通过选择能量剩余最大的节点作为下一个中继节点来实现能耗均衡的。这种选择方式可以使节点尽可能地共享负载,同时也可以使网络中的每个节点能量消耗均衡,从而提高整个传感器网络的寿命。 在能耗均衡路由协议中,我们还需要确定最优选择的中继节点。为了找到最优的中继节点,可以采用如下三种方法之一: 1.基于距离测量的方法:该方法采用节点之间的距离作为距离测量指标。选择距离最近且剩余能量最大的节点作为下一个中继节点。 2.基于链路预测的方法:该方法通过节点之间的交互信息来进行链路质量的预测。选择预测结果最好的节点作为下一个中继节点。 3.基于负载平衡的方法:该方法选择能量剩余最大的节点并考虑节点当前的负载情况。节点负载越小,则该节点越适合作为中继节点。 四、基于能量均衡的路由协议设计 为了实现能耗均衡路由协议,我们提出了一种基于负载平衡的路由协议。该协议首先选择当前能量最大的节点作为下一个中继节点,然后同时考虑节点负载情况来优化中继节点的选择。此外,对于节点之间的距离,我们采用预测模型来求解节点之间的距离,以优化路由的选择。 该协议可以有效地减少节点能量消耗不均衡的情况,同时也可以提高整个传感器网络的寿命。通过仿真实验,我们可以看出该协议的效果是良好的。 结论 本论文主要研究了能耗均衡的无线传感器网络路由协议,分析了无线传感器网络中节点能源限制的问题和现有路由协议的优缺点。我们提出了一种基于负载平衡的路由协议,通过设计有效的转发机制来实现能耗均衡。通过仿真实验,我们可以看出该协议的效果是良好的,可以在实际应用中得到广泛的应用。